1/* SPDX-License-Identifier: GPL-2.0 */
2#ifndef __NETNS_SCTP_H__
3#define __NETNS_SCTP_H__
4
5struct sock;
6struct proc_dir_entry;
7struct sctp_mib;
8struct ctl_table_header;
9
10struct netns_sctp {
11 DEFINE_SNMP_STAT(struct sctp_mib, sctp_statistics);
12
13#ifdef CONFIG_PROC_FS
14 struct proc_dir_entry *proc_net_sctp;
15#endif
16#ifdef CONFIG_SYSCTL
17 struct ctl_table_header *sysctl_header;
18#endif
19 /* This is the global socket data structure used for responding to
20 * the Out-of-the-blue (OOTB) packets. A control sock will be created
21 * for this socket at the initialization time.
22 */
23 struct sock *ctl_sock;
24
25 /* UDP tunneling listening sock. */
26 struct sock *udp4_sock;
27 struct sock *udp6_sock;
28 /* UDP tunneling listening port. */
29 int udp_port;
30 /* UDP tunneling remote encap port. */
31 int encap_port;
32
33 /* This is the global local address list.
34 * We actively maintain this complete list of addresses on
35 * the system by catching address add/delete events.
36 *
37 * It is a list of sctp_sockaddr_entry.
38 */
39 struct list_head local_addr_list;
40 struct list_head addr_waitq;
41 struct timer_list addr_wq_timer;
42 struct list_head auto_asconf_splist;
43 /* Lock that protects both addr_waitq and auto_asconf_splist */
44 spinlock_t addr_wq_lock;
45
46 /* Lock that protects the local_addr_list writers */
47 spinlock_t local_addr_lock;
48
49 /* RFC2960 Section 14. Suggested SCTP Protocol Parameter Values
50 *
51 * The following protocol parameters are RECOMMENDED:
52 *
53 * RTO.Initial - 3 seconds
54 * RTO.Min - 1 second
55 * RTO.Max - 60 seconds
56 * RTO.Alpha - 1/8 (3 when converted to right shifts.)
57 * RTO.Beta - 1/4 (2 when converted to right shifts.)
58 */
59 unsigned int rto_initial;
60 unsigned int rto_min;
61 unsigned int rto_max;
62
63 /* Note: rto_alpha and rto_beta are really defined as inverse
64 * powers of two to facilitate integer operations.
65 */
66 int rto_alpha;
67 int rto_beta;
68
69 /* Max.Burst - 4 */
70 int max_burst;
71
72 /* Whether Cookie Preservative is enabled(1) or not(0) */
73 int cookie_preserve_enable;
74
75 /* The namespace default hmac alg */
76 char *sctp_hmac_alg;
77
78 /* Valid.Cookie.Life - 60 seconds */
79 unsigned int valid_cookie_life;
80
81 /* Delayed SACK timeout 200ms default*/
82 unsigned int sack_timeout;
83
84 /* HB.interval - 30 seconds */
85 unsigned int hb_interval;
86
87 /* The interval for PLPMTUD probe timer */
88 unsigned int probe_interval;
89
90 /* Association.Max.Retrans - 10 attempts
91 * Path.Max.Retrans - 5 attempts (per destination address)
92 * Max.Init.Retransmits - 8 attempts
93 */
94 int max_retrans_association;
95 int max_retrans_path;
96 int max_retrans_init;
97 /* Potentially-Failed.Max.Retrans sysctl value
98 * taken from:
99 * http://tools.ietf.org/html/draft-nishida-tsvwg-sctp-failover-05
100 */
101 int pf_retrans;
102
103 /* Primary.Switchover.Max.Retrans sysctl value
104 * taken from:
105 * https://tools.ietf.org/html/rfc7829
106 */
107 int ps_retrans;
108
109 /*
110 * Disable Potentially-Failed feature, the feature is enabled by default
111 * pf_enable - 0 : disable pf
112 * - >0 : enable pf
113 */
114 int pf_enable;
115
116 /*
117 * Disable Potentially-Failed state exposure, ignored by default
118 * pf_expose - 0 : compatible with old applications (by default)
119 * - 1 : disable pf state exposure
120 * - 2 : enable pf state exposure
121 */
122 int pf_expose;
123
124 /*
125 * Policy for preforming sctp/socket accounting
126 * 0 - do socket level accounting, all assocs share sk_sndbuf
127 * 1 - do sctp accounting, each asoc may use sk_sndbuf bytes
128 */
129 int sndbuf_policy;
130
131 /*
132 * Policy for preforming sctp/socket accounting
133 * 0 - do socket level accounting, all assocs share sk_rcvbuf
134 * 1 - do sctp accounting, each asoc may use sk_rcvbuf bytes
135 */
136 int rcvbuf_policy;
137
138 int default_auto_asconf;
139
140 /* Flag to indicate if addip is enabled. */
141 int addip_enable;
142 int addip_noauth;
143
144 /* Flag to indicate if PR-SCTP is enabled. */
145 int prsctp_enable;
146
147 /* Flag to indicate if PR-CONFIG is enabled. */
148 int reconf_enable;
149
150 /* Flag to indicate if SCTP-AUTH is enabled */
151 int auth_enable;
152
153 /* Flag to indicate if stream interleave is enabled */
154 int intl_enable;
155
156 /* Flag to indicate if ecn is enabled */
157 int ecn_enable;
158
159 /*
160 * Policy to control SCTP IPv4 address scoping
161 * 0 - Disable IPv4 address scoping
162 * 1 - Enable IPv4 address scoping
163 * 2 - Selectively allow only IPv4 private addresses
164 * 3 - Selectively allow only IPv4 link local address
165 */
166 int scope_policy;
167
168 /* Threshold for rwnd update SACKS. Receive buffer shifted this many
169 * bits is an indicator of when to send and window update SACK.
170 */
171 int rwnd_upd_shift;
172
173 /* Threshold for autoclose timeout, in seconds. */
174 unsigned long max_autoclose;
175};
176
177#endif /* __NETNS_SCTP_H__ */
